43. Visiting Hours.
Written by: Adam Beechen.
Aired: 27 May 2005.
Ami and Yumi come back to their tour bus and find a note that Kaz left saying that he had to go to the hospital. When they visit the hospital, they face a tough nurse who refuses to let them see Kaz.

44. Kitty Kontest.
Written by: Mike Kazaleh.
Aired: 27 May 2005.
Kaz enters Ami and Yumi's cats in a contest but turns out the cat contest isn't for a few months, so Kaz decides to enter the cats in a dog contest by pretending that they're dogs.

45. Chow Down.
Written by: David Shayne.
Aired: 27 May 2005.
Unlike Ami and Kaz, Yumi has never won a trophy before. Intent on winning one, she enters a tofu-dog eating contest. However, she faces a very tough competitor.
